不同方法构建磺胺二甲氧嘧啶免疫抗原的比较研究 被引量:5

The study of comparison on two sulfadimethoxine immunizing antigens constructed with two different methods

摘要 为探讨合成磺胺二甲氧嘧啶 (SDM)免疫抗原的有效途径 ,采用重氮偶合法和戊二醛法分别合成SDM免疫抗原 ,并对其结构特征、光谱特征和SDM结合比进行比较。结果表明 ,在合成SDM_BSA中采用重氮偶合法比戊二醛法好。 In order to explore an effective way of synthesizing the sulfadimethoxine (SDM) immunizing antigen, the two SDM immunizing antigens were synthesized with the method of diazotization and coupling or glutaraldehyde. And the two SDM immunizing antigens were compared in the structure characteristic, spectrum characteristic, and SDM-BSA (bovine serum albumin) combination Ratios. The results showed that in synthesizing SDM-BSA it is better with the method of diazotization and coupling than the glutaraldehyde.
